What gland is located in the upper left quadrant of the abdomen and releases hormones from the A and B cells?

The gland located in the upper left quadrant of the abdomen is the pancreas. It contains A cells (alpha cells) that produce glucagon and B cells (beta cells) that produce insulin. These hormones play crucial roles in regulating blood sugar levels in the body. The pancreas functions as both an endocrine and exocrine gland.

What is the large gland in the upper right part of the abdomen?

The large gland in the upper right part of the abdomen is the liver. It plays a crucial role in various bodily functions, including detoxification, metabolism, and the production of bile, which aids in digestion. The liver also stores nutrients and helps regulate blood sugar levels. Its size and location make it a vital organ for overall health.
